Exeter, office based
Up to £35,000 basic + uncapped commission OTE circa £50,000
Customs, logistics or import/export background? Looking for a more commercial role?
We're recruiting for a Sales Executive to join a growing customs and logistics business based in Exeter. This role would suit someone who understands customs, freight forwarding, logistics, transport.

How to prepare for a job interview at Pivotal Recruit
✨Know Your Customs and Logistics
Make sure you brush up on your knowledge of customs, freight forwarding, and logistics. Be prepared to discuss specific scenarios where you've applied this knowledge in previous roles. This will show that you understand the industry and can hit the ground running.
✨Showcase Your Sales Skills
Prepare examples of how you've successfully closed deals or built relationships with clients in the past.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ure your answers. This will help demonstrate your sales acumen and ability to drive results.
✨Research the Company
Take some time to learn about the customs and logistics business you're interviewing with. Understand their services, target market, and recent news. This will not only help you tailor your answers but also show your genuine interest in the role and the company.
✨Ask Insightful Questions
Prepare thoughtful questions to ask at the end of the interview. Inquire about the company's growth plans, team dynamics, or challenges they face in the industry. This shows that you're engaged and thinking critically about how you can contribute to their success.
